The AirPods Pro’s battery life is a significant factor in their appeal, as it allows users to enjoy uninterrupted audio for several hours. According to Apple’s official specifications, the AirPods Pro can last up to 5 hours on a single charge, with an additional 19 hours of battery life provided by the charging case. This means that users can recharge their AirPods Pro on the go, ensuring that they remain functional throughout the day. The battery life of the AirPods Pro can be affected by various factors, including the volume level, the use of noise-cancellation features, and the type of audio content being played.

Factors Affecting AirPods Pro Battery Life

Several factors can impact the battery life of the AirPods Pro, including the volume level at which they are used. Listening to audio at higher volumes can reduce the battery life, as the earbuds require more power to produce sound. Additionally, the use of noise-cancellation features, such as Active Noise Cancellation (ANC) and Transparency mode, can also affect the battery life. ANC, in particular, requires more power to function, which can result in a shorter battery life. Furthermore, the type of audio content being played can also influence the battery life, with more complex audio files, such as those with high bitrates, requiring more power to decode and play.

💡 To maximize the battery life of the AirPods Pro, users can take several steps, including turning off ANC when not needed, reducing the volume level, and avoiding extreme temperatures, which can affect the battery's performance.

In addition to these factors, the battery life of the AirPods Pro can also be affected by the age of the battery, with older batteries typically having a shorter lifespan. However, Apple's battery management system, which is designed to optimize battery performance and longevity, can help to mitigate this effect. Real-World Testing and Results

Real-world testing of the AirPods Pro has shown that they can last for several hours on a single charge, even with heavy use. For example, a test conducted by CNET found that the AirPods Pro lasted for 4 hours and 48 minutes with ANC enabled, while a test by The Verge found that they lasted for 5 hours and 2 minutes with ANC disabled. These results demonstrate that the AirPods Pro’s battery life is consistent with Apple’s official specifications and can withstand extended use in real-world scenarios.
